DTF transfers on dark fabrics: Mastering opacity and heat press settings
DTF transfers on dark fabrics are most opaque when you build a dense white underbase and select inks with high coverage. Opacity is crucial to prevent the base fabric color from showing through on black or navy garments, so plan color layering—often two or more passes above the white layer—to achieve vibrant results without edge cracking. For dark fabrics, start with typical heat press settings of 160–180°C (320–356°F) for 12–20 seconds, applying firm, even pressure. Always run a test print on a similar fabric to dial in timing and pressure for your printer, film, and adhesive.
Materials choice drives opacity and durability. Use transfer films with high opacity, white and color inks with strong coverage, and an adhesive that bonds well to cotton, blends, and poly blends. Because you’re aiming for opaque DTF transfers, ensure the white underbase is dense enough to mask the fabric color, and layer colors in stages to avoid excessive ink on the film. After pressing, a brief post-press cure and a controlled cooldown help reduce edge lifting, and you can compare DTF on dark fabrics to DTG or screen printing to choose the best workflow for small runs and on-demand orders.
Opaque coverage and durability: optimizing curing and wash durability of DTF transfers on dark fabrics
Curing is the stage where the adhesive and ink reach full bond strength with the fabric. For dark fabrics, proper curing supports the curing and wash durability of DTF transfers by reducing cracking and wash fade. After removing the transfer, allow the garment to cool slightly and complete a brief post-press cure if your film recommends it, then follow the garment with standard care instructions. Turn garments inside out before washing, use cold or warm water cycles with a mild detergent, and avoid chlorine bleach or harsh solvents during the first 5–10 wash cycles to preserve opacity and colorfastness of the opaque DTF transfers.

| Aspect | Key Points |
|---|---|
| Overview of DTF on dark fabrics | Direct-to-film transfers on dark fabrics aim for opaque, vibrant prints by masking the base fabric color with dense white underbase and high-opacity layers. This approach is particularly advantageous on black or navy garments. |
| Opacity and ink density | White underbase should be dense; plan color layering (often 2+ passes) to build vivid colors on dark garments. Proper opacity prevents ghosting and ensures durability. |
| Materials | Use films with high opacity, white and color DTF inks with strong coverage, reliable adhesive, and a heat press with even pressure. Run test prints to verify underbase and color development before production. |
| Preparation | Start with clean, dry fabrics; follow garment pre-treatment washing/drying guidelines if applicable. A light pre-press (about 5–8 seconds) reduces moisture and wrinkles to improve transfer contact. |
| Step-by-step application | Heat press settings (typical): 160–180°C (320–356°F), 12–20 seconds, firm even pressure. Adjust dwell time/pressure to ensure white underbase bonds well on dark fabrics; perform test prints to dial in params. |
| Post-press handling | Peel after cooling slightly or while warm for certain films; a brief post-press (2–5 seconds, light pressure) can improve bonding and edge quality. |
| Curing and wash durability | Proper curing prevents cracking, fading, or peeling. Turn garments inside out before washing; use cold/warm cycles with mild detergent; avoid chlorine bleach during first 5–10 washes to maximize durability. |
| DTF vs screen printing | DTF offers flexibility and easier setup for small runs or on-demand work, with strong color and detail. Screen printing can be more economical for large runs but is more complex for multicolor designs. |
| Troubleshooting | Ghosting: increase white underbase opacity or adjust color layering. Cracking/peeling: verify curing, pressure, and temperature. Uneven edges: ensure flat garment and full, even contact. Durability: reassess curing and washing steps. |
| Practical tips | Run calibration tests on different fabrics; maintain a log of effective heat press settings; store films properly; pre-treat fabrics when recommended; invest in a quality heat press with even temperature distribution. |
